Ingevity Corporation (NGVT) reported first-quarter 2026 earnings per share of $1.15, significantly exceeding the consensus estimate of $0.7931—a positive surprise of 45%. Revenue details were not disclosed in the available data. Following the release, the stock price rose by $2.24, reflecting investor enthusiasm over the bottom-line performance.
